function y = polyval(c,x)
#Evaluate a polynomial.
#
#In octave, a polynomial is represented by it's coefficients (arranged
#in descending order). For example a vector c of length n+1 corresponds
#to the following nth order polynomial
#
#  p(x) = c(1) x^n + ... + c(n) x + c(n+1).
#
#polyval(c,x) will evaluate the polynomial at the specified value of x.
#
#If x is a vector or matrix, the polynomial is evaluated at each of the
#elements of x.
#
#SEE ALSO: polyvalm, poly, roots, conv, deconv, residue, filter,
#          polyderiv, polyinteg

  if(nargin != 2)
    error("usage: polyval(c,x)");
  endif

  if(is_matrix(c))
    error("poly: first argument must be a vector.");
  endif

  if(length(c) == 0)
    y = c;
    return;
  endif

  n = length(c);
  y = c(1)*ones(rows(x),columns(x));
  for index = 2:n
    y = c(index) + x .* y;
  endfor
endfunction
